Sanatan Dharma and Astrology: An Ancient Connection

Origins of Sanatan Dharma and Astrology

Sanatan Dharma, often referred to as Hinduism, is an ancient spiritual tradition rooted in the Vedic texts of India, dating back over 5,000 years. Meaning “eternal order,” it encompasses a way of life guided by cosmic harmony and spiritual wisdom. Astrology, or Jyotish Shastra (the science of light), is a vital component of Sanatan Dharma, originating from the Vedas, particularly the Rigveda and Atharvaveda. Jyotish, as an auxiliary discipline of the Vedas (Vedanga), was designed to harmonize human activities with the cosmic rhythms. This ancient practice uses planetary positions to interpret life events, emphasizing the interconnectedness of the universe and individual destinies.

The Link Between Sanatan Dharma and Astrology

In Sanatan Dharma, astrology is more than just predicting the future—it serves as a sacred guide to understanding dharma (righteous duty), karma (the law of cause and effect), and moksha (liberation from the cycle of rebirth). The philosophy holds that celestial entities influence human lives, reflecting karmic traces from past existences. For example, the Navagrahas (nine celestial deities) are venerated within Sanatan Dharma, with practices like Navagraha Puja conducted to harmonize planetary forces. Birth charts, known as Kundalis, plot the positions of planets at the time of birth, directing individuals toward their spiritual and earthly goals. This connection reinforces the Sanatan ethos of aligning life with universal cosmic principles.

Insights and Reasons for Their Connection

Astrology in Sanatan Dharma provides insights into life’s challenges and opportunities. By analyzing planetary transits, such as Saturn’s Sade Sati or Rahu-Ketu transits, practitioners gain clarity on timing for major life decisions, like marriage or career changes. The reason for this deep connection lies in the Vedic worldview: the cosmos is a divine manifestation, and human life is a microcosm of the universe. Astrology offers practical tools, like Muhurta (auspicious timing), to align actions with favorable planetary energies, enhancing success and spiritual growth. Temples dedicated to Navagrahas across India highlight this integration, blending devotion with cosmic awareness.

Why Astrology Matters in Sanatan Dharma

Astrology serves as a bridge between the material and spiritual realms in Sanatan Dharma. It helps individuals navigate life’s uncertainties by offering remedies like gemstones, mantras, or charity to mitigate negative planetary influences. For instance, reciting the Vishnu Sahasranama or wearing a blue sapphire to align with Saturn’s energy can restore cosmic balance. This approach supports the Sanatan belief in harmonizing free will with destiny, enabling individuals to make conscious decisions while honoring universal cycles.
